Here is your opportunity to help and help shape the future of PMI OVOC. Get involved! Each director is elected for a two-year term. Board members elect the President, President-Elect, Secretary, and Treasurer from amongst their number. Other directors will be responsible for a portfolio (Professional Development, Membership, Volunteer Management, Marketing, Technology, Partnerships, Programs, Director-at-large) and will co-ordinate the effort of volunteers. Board meetings are held on the second Wednesday of each month in the evening. The estimated time commitment is from 20 to 30 hours a month depending upon the portfolio a director is responsible for. The Project Economy PMI has introduced a new way of working called “The Project Economy” which has organizations and people-centred around a portfolio of projects to deliver outcomes.  PMI has developed a language and the qualities required to be a part of it: collaboration, determination, change, innovation, teamwork, outcomes, growth, vision and community. As well, as a symbol to use in communications, to reinforce their meaning. For full details of The Project Economy, click here. Symbol Meanings The Project Mark The Project Mark consists of the letter 'P' to represent ‘Project’ and symbols from the language of The Project Economy, representing collaboration, determination, and change. PMI knows that a project is everything from the Euro and Google’s search engine to everyday assignments. That’s why we’re elevating “Project” in our mark. The Masterbrand Logo The PMI logo is the most singular visual expression of who PMI Global and Chapters are! PMI pairs the Project Mark with the “Project Management Institute” wordmark to form the logo. The typographic treatment elevates “Project” by spelling it out and creates hierarchy within the wordmark by using the bold weight. PMI OVOC Chapter Logos   Colour Palette Our primary colour palette expresses our Brand Personality–fearless, bright, and nurturing - through three core colours: Tangerine, Aqua, and Violet. These colours combined create an approachable and energetic atmosphere, that helps build a recognizable look and feel for PMI.  Applying PMI’s core colour palette will build brand awareness by creating a strong connection across all of our brand touchpoints, from our website to event signage. In most cases, our three core colours and black and white should be all you need to make distinct PMI communications. Course Description Agile teams are a must in this world of intense competition, market demands, and changing expectations. Global virtual teaming has become a necessity as organizations become increasingly distributed, with suppliers and clients actively engaged in joint projects. Agile teams now work across geographical, organizational, and cultural boundaries to deliver solutions and services to global users. Distance and differences may amplify the effect of issues and factors, that are relatively straightforward for co-located Agile teams. This course provides practical concepts and techniques that participants can start using immediately with their virtual Agile teams. The goal of the course is to enable you to successfully execute your preferred Agile or Scrum methods in a virtual project team environment.
